Career positions & opportunities
Career Opportunity Description
Care Assistant Provide personal care and support to individuals in residential settings or their own homes. Assist with daily activities and promote independence.
Support Worker Work with vulnerable individuals to help them live fulfilling lives. Provide emotional support, assistance with daily tasks, and advocacy.
Healthcare Assistant Assist healthcare professionals in hospitals, clinics, or community settings. Provide basic care, monitor patients, and support medical procedures.
Social Worker Support individuals and families facing challenges such as abuse, addiction, or mental health issues. Assess needs, develop care plans, and provide resources.
Care Coordinator Organize and oversee care services for individuals with complex needs. Coordinate with healthcare professionals, families, and community resources.

Course content
    • Promote communication in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
    • Engage in personal development in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
    • Promote equality and inclusion in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
    • Principles for implementing duty of care in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
    • Understand the factors affecting older people
    • Understand the factors affecting individuals with learning disabilities
    • Understand the factors affecting individuals with mental health conditions
    • Understand the factors affecting individuals with physical disabilities
    • Understand the factors affecting individuals with sensory loss
    • Understand the factors affecting individuals with substance misuse issues
Assessment

Assessment is via assignment submission
